In north america the appalacina dulcimer is envolved from european Scheitholt or Hummel from north Germany and is popular in the folcmusic. The Appalachian Dulcimer has 4 strings. The both high strings are tuned the same, the others are a quint and octave to the base note.

A typical tuning is d - g - d' - d'

The frets are diatonic.

Like a zither on a table or on the legs of the player, the strings could be plucked or striked. You touch just one string or all three together for example with a bamboostick. Typical it is played with a bottleneck, to slide between the frets. Cause the tuning in quints you can play with open strings and bordun or accords.
